Advanced grammar involves understanding the nuances of epistemic modality and the restrictive nature of relative clauses. Mark T (True) or F (False) for the statements regarding these structures.(__)The modal verb "must" in "He must be exhausted after the marathon" expresses epistemic necessity (logical deduction), not obligation.(__)In the sentence "The theory, that I described earlier, is complex," the use of "that" is grammatically correct for a non-restrictive clause.(__)The pronoun "whom" is mandatory, in formal English, when it functions as the complement of a preposition (e.g., "The person to whom I spoke").(__)The conjunction "lest" is followed by the subjunctive mood or "should", expressing a negative purpose (e.g., "Lest he forget").Select the alternative that presents the correct sequence, from top to bottom.
- AF, T, F, T.
- BF, F, T, T.
- CT, F, T, T.
- DT, T, F, F.
